Thanks for the suggestion. You're right - it renames the original file, uploads a new one and then deletes the old copy. I checked a different client and that one simply issues a STOR command. I emailed the author a request to change this behavior. Thanks again Itai
Have a look at the ZServer logs, and see what it's doing. I'm guessing that it's deleting the object, then creating it again, when writing it out.
